Management and Supervisory Responsibilities
- Supervises and oversees assigned projects
- Assists Preconstruction Manager, MEP Manager, and onsite Project Management Team
- Handles any personnel issues that may arise on assigned projects
- Interface with CxA to ensure the Cx process is being executed to meet project expectations
- Ability to review MEP submittals
- Review MEP scopes of work for accuracy and completeness
- Review material/equipment technical submittals from MEP subcontractors and validate specification compliance
- Enforce quality control plan
- Assist in the development of the MEP Construction and Commissioning Schedule
- Oversee MEP installation
- Perform inspections for MEP subcontractor product installation
- Coordinate equipment startup and communicate startup dates with CxA
- Assist in MEP punch list phase of project
- Coordinates with the superintendent on MEP trade progress
- Weekly Cx schedule meetings with onsite superintendent to ensure project is meeting commissioning goals and requirements
- Works with the project team to establish goals and develop accountability.
- Attends regular staff meetings for coordination and development of staff and resolution of critical issues. In addition, reviews RFI’s, ASI’s, CCD’s, etc., that could have potential schedule and cost impacts relating to MEP/Cx.
- Ability to maintain good working relationships with subcontractor’s onsite management team.
- Ability to lead weekly subcontractor Cx meetings and communicate project deadlines
- Professional License in Mechanical Engineering, MEP trade certification, or a Bachelor's degree in Construction Management.
- 5–10 years of experience in commercial mechanical construction, with a strong background in managing and overseeing complex building systems, including:
- Plumbing and Piping Systems – Installation, coordination, and quality control of water distribution, drainage, and gas piping systems.
- HVAC Systems – Implementation of heating, ventilation, and air conditioning solutions, ensuring efficiency, compliance, and system integration.
- Fire Protection and Suppression Systems – Oversight of fire sprinkler systems, standpipes, and other fire safety measures to meet code requirements.
- Fire Alarm and Life Safety Systems – Coordination of fire detection, alarm, and emergency response systems to ensure proper installation and operation.
- Temperature Control and Building Automation – Integration of advanced control systems for climate regulation, energy efficiency, and automated building operations.
